Leeds (The Leeds Times) September 12, 2026 — Three people have been taken into police custody following a violent early morning incident in the Harehills district of the city that left a man hospitalised with serious knife wounds.Emergency services flooded the Harehills area of Leeds shortly after 5:00 am following urgent calls reporting a serious assault involving a bladed weapon. Officers from West Yorkshire Police, alongside regional ambulance crews, were dispatched immediately to Harehills Lane where they located a male victim suffering from severe trauma.
A spokesperson for West Yorkshire Police detailed the initial response to the unfolding emergency, stating that a man in his thirties was swiftly treated at the scene before being conveyed to a local hospital. The representative formally stated:
“A man in his 30s was taken to hospital with serious stab wounds. His injuries are not thought to be life-threatening.”
Who Has Been Arrested in Connection With the Leeds Assault?
Police action was initiated swiftly following the morning emergency response, leading to multiple targeted arrests as detectives launched an immediate investigation into the sequence of events. Authorities confirmed that a joint apprehension effort resulted in the detention of three suspects linked directly to the violent altercation.
Providing an update on the status of the suspects, the West Yorkshire Police spokesperson added:
“Two men and a woman have been arrested in relation to this serious assault and remain in police custody while enquiries are ongoing.”
Detectives have not yet released the exact ages or specific identities of those detained as local investigative teams continue gathering forensic evidence and reviewing potential CCTV footage from the surrounding commercial and residential streets.
